Exotic plant species profoundly impact ecosystems, often displacing native vegetation and disrupting ecological balance. This study investigates their effects within the Sursuti Medicinal Plant Conservation Area (MPCA), located in the core region of Gorumara National Park, India. Through field surveys and phytosociological analyses, we assessed the exotic flora's composition, distribution, and ecological significance. Asteraceae and Solanaceae are predominant among herbs and shrubs from diverse tropical Americas, Africa, and Madagascar. Phytosociological studies highlight the ecological dominance of certain species, while diversity indices suggest potential impacts on native biodiversity. Indicator value analysis identifies vital species associated with different seasons, offering insights into their ecological roles. Exotic species pose challenges in habitat alteration. Effective management measures, including invasive species control and habitat restoration, are crucial for preserving the ecological integrity of the MPCA. This study contributes to biodiversity conservation efforts and underscores the importance of addressing exotic plant pressure in protected areas.
